Embodiment 1
[0020] The introduction of a certain point mutation in the embodiment
[0021] 1. Design of mutant primers: Design the mutant amino acid codons into the primer sequence according to the corresponding primer design principles, namely Arg(AGG)→Ile(GAG), His(CAC)→Phe(TCC). The primer sequences are: upstream, SEQ ID NO. 3cctgtcctcatctggaacaaggtaaaaATAggtTTCtatggagttcaaaggac; downstream, SEQ ID NO. 4gtcctttgaactccataGAAaccTATttttaccttgttccagatgaggacagg.
[0022] 2. Introduce mutant PCR reaction: Dissolve the above primers to 10uM, dilute the wild-type IGFBP7-pET28a plasmid to 10ng / ul, use a DNA polymerase with high fidelity performance, and use a 50ul amplification system as follows: 5*buffer 10ul, dNTP 4ul , upstream primer 1ul, downstream primer 1ul, DNA template 1ul, polymerase 1ul, double distilled water 32ul. Embodiment 2
[0027] Expression and purification of target protein
[0028] 1. Transform the expression strain BL21 and select the positive expression strain: transform the expression vector IGFBP7-pET28a successfully sequenced into the E. coli expression strain BL21, take 2ul of the plasmid (100ng / ul) and add it to 200 μl of prepared competent E. coli BL21, ice After bathing for 30 minutes, heat shock at 42°C for 90 seconds, then ice-bath for 3 minutes; add 800 μl LB liquid medium, shake the bacteria at 37°C, 150 rpm for 1 hour, and then take 200 μl of bacterial liquid and spread evenly on kanamycin-positive ( 50 μg / ml) on LB agar plates. Invert the plate and place in a 37°C incubator for 12-16h. Pick 3-5 clones and shake them overnight for culture, and re-inoculate each clone into two tubes of 4ml kanamycin-resistant liquid LB medium to divide them into (+) (-) controls. Embodiment 3
[0036] Example 3 Western blot verification of the binding ability of the mutant protein to insulin
[0037] 1. Membrane spotting: Take 2.5ul each of wild-type protein (W) and two mutant proteins (M2) at the same concentration and spot on nitrocellulose membrane (NC membrane). After natural drying, use 5% bovine serum at room temperature Albumin (BSA) blocked for 2 hours.
[0038] 2. Quantification: The membrane was incubated with a monoclonal antibody to IGFBP7 (mouse source, TBST milk dilution ratio 1:5000), incubated at room temperature for half an hour and then placed at 4°C overnight. The next day, they were incubated at room temperature for 20 minutes, and washed three times with Tris-HCl buffer (TBST) containing Tween-20 for 5 minutes each time.
